新型青蒿素凝胶及其制备方法

一类青蒿素或脱氧青蒿素的12位或11位和12位取代的衍生物,它们可由二氢青蒿素类化合物出发,通过醚化、酯化、胺化、水解、曼尼许反应制备生成。带胺基的青蒿素类化合物与无机酸或有机酸能制成人体生理上可接受的盐,经初步药理筛选发现它们具有多种生物活性;抗寄生虫病、抗爱滋病及其相关病、抗癌、免疫调节等方面的活性,这些衍生物有的油溶性大,有的水溶性好,易于制剂,具有成药前景。
 
新型青蒿素衍生物及其制备方法
本发明属有机化学中萜类化合物青蒿素衍生物及其制备方法。
青蒿(菊科植物黄花蒿Artemisia annua)是常用中药。李时珍“本草纲目”记载,青蒿苦、寒、无毒,主治疥疮痂痒、恶疮、疟疾寒热、虚劳寒热、骨蒸烦热、心痛热黄、赤白痢下等病。七十年代初,中国科学家从青蒿中提取分离到抗疟有效成份青蒿素,它的化学结构式为:天然青蒿素具有抗疟活性,但由于它有溶解度小,制剂困难和复燃率高的不足,致使它的广泛应用受到了限制,这就促使科学家们致力于青蒿素的结构改造工作,以解决上述问题。中国科学家发明了抗疟活性高于青蒿素的蒿甲醚和青蒿琥酯的新抗疟药。前者溶于油,后者的钠盐溶于水,但这一水溶液稳定性差。欧洲专利[EP0362730(1989年)]报道了二氢青蒿素的醚类及硫醚类衍生物(其中包括含碱性基团的青蒿醚类)的抗疟作用、提及它们兼有抗阿米巴和抗球虫作用。美国专利[US4816478(1989年)]提到二氢青蒿素的醚类,酯类衍生物有抗艾滋病及其相关病的作用,但无具体化学结构。中国专利[CN 89109562.4(1989年)]报道了一类含有碱性基团可制成盐的水溶性青蒿素衍生物。
近年的药学杂志报道,中国科技人员对青蒿及青蒿素类除抗疟外的其他生物活性作了广泛的探索,有的已在临床上试用成功,例如对急性上感高热的退烧作用,红斑狼疮的治疗、鸡球虫病的防治、牛羊焦虫病的防治、牛血吸虫病的防治、猪弓形虫病的治疗等,这些研究结果给人启迪。
为探索青蒿素类化合物的潜在药用价值,本发明旨在设计新的合成路线,合成并提供更多类型的青蒿素衍生物。

Artemisin derivant and its preparation method

The present invention relates to 11 position or/and 12 position substituted derivates of artemisinin or deoxidized artemisinin, which can be prepared by carrying out etherealization, esterification, oxidation, aminolysis reaction, hydrolyzation and Manish reaction on dihydroartemisinin compounds. An artemisinin compound with amido can be prepared into a human physiology acceptable salt together with inorganic acid or organic acid. The derivates have various kinds of bioactivity by preliminary pharmacological sieving, such as the anti-parasitic disease activity, the activity of anti-AIDS and relevant diseases, the anticancer activity, the immunological regulation activity, etc. Some derivates have high lipid solubility, and some derivates have high water solubility. The derivates can be easily prepared into preparations and have pharmaceutical prospect.
 
Artemisin derivant and preparation method thereof
The invention belongs to terpenoid artemisinin derivative and preparation method thereof in the organic chemistry.
Sweet wormwood (feverfew Herba Artemisiae annuae Artemisia annua) is a conventional Chinese medicine.LI Shi-Zhen " Compendium of Materia Medica " record, sweet wormwood hardship, cold, nontoxic cures mainly the scabies scab and itches, dislikes sore, malaria fever and chills, consumptive disease fever and chills, hectic fever due to yin dysphoria with smothery sensation, yellow, the inferior disease of dysentery with red and white feces of pained heat.Early seventies, extraction separation is to antimalarial effective ingredient Artemisinin from sweet wormwood for the Chinese science man, and its chemical structural formula is: Natural Artemisinin has antimalarial active, but because it has solubleness little, preparation difficulty and the high deficiency of recrudescence rate cause its widespread use to be restricted, and this just impels scientists to be devoted to the structure of modification work of Artemisinin, to address the above problem.The Chinese science man has invented antimalarial active and has been higher than the Artemether of Artemisinin and the new antimalarial drug of Artesunate.The former is dissolved in oil, and the latter's sodium salt is water-soluble, but this aqueous stability is poor.European patent [EP0362730 (1989)] reported the ethers of Dihydroartemisinin and thioether analog derivative (comprising the sweet wormwood ethers that contains basic group) the antimalarial effect, mention that they have anti-amoeba and anticoccidial effect concurrently.United States Patent (USP) [US4816478 (1989)] is mentioned the ethers of Dihydroartemisinin, and ester derivative has the effect of anti-AIDS and related diseases thereof, but does not have particular chemical.Chinese patent [CN 89109562.4 (1989)] has reported that a class contains the water-soluble arteannuin derivant that basic group can be made into salt.
In recent years pharmaceutical journal report, the Chinese science and technology personnel to sweet wormwood and artemisine the other biological activity except that antimalarial done widely to explore, what have tries out successfully clinically, for example to the acute effect of bringing down a fever of going up the high heat of sense, the treatments of the control of the treatment of lupus erythematosus, the control of coccidiosis of chicken, cattle and sheep babesiasis, the control of bos sinicus, pig toxoplasmosis etc., these results of study edify to the people.
Be to explore the potential pharmaceutical use of artemisine compounds, the present invention is intended to design new synthetic route, and is synthetic and more eurypalynous artemisinin derivative is provided.
